Different projects have different electrical, mechanical, and thermal requirements. For instance, if you&#8217;re building a transformer, you&#8217;ll need an enamel wire that can handle high voltages and have low electrical resistance. On the other hand, if you&#8217;re creating a small motor for a toy, the wire won&#8217;t need to handle as much power, but it should be flexible enough to wind easily.<\/p>\n<p>Think about the current and voltage your project will need. The wire&#8217;s gauge (thickness) plays a big role here. Thicker wires can handle more current, but they might not be suitable if you&#8217;re working in a tight space. You&#8217;ll also want to consider the frequency of the electrical signal. In high &#8211; frequency applications, the skin effect becomes important. This means that the current tends to flow more on the outer surface of the wire. So, for high &#8211; frequency projects, you might want to look into special enamel wires designed to minimize the impact of the skin effect.<\/p>\n<p>The mechanical properties of the wire are also super important. If your wire will be subjected to bending, twisting, or vibration, it needs to be strong and flexible. Some enamel wires are more brittle than others, so you&#8217;ll want to pick one that can withstand the mechanical stress of your project.<\/p>\n<h3>Consider the Enamel Type<\/h3>\n<p>The enamel coating on the wire is what gives it its electrical insulation properties, and there are different types to choose from.<\/p>\n<p><strong>Polyurethane Enamel<\/strong>: This is a popular choice for a lot of applications. It&#8217;s easy to solder, which is a big plus if you&#8217;re doing some DIY soldering work. It also has good thermal properties and can handle temperatures up to around 130\u00b0C. So, if you&#8217;re working on a project where soldering is required and the temperature isn&#8217;t too extreme, polyurethane enamel wire could be a great option.<\/p>\n<p><strong>Polyester Enamel<\/strong>: Polyester &#8211; coated enamel wires are known for their good chemical resistance and mechanical strength. They can handle higher temperatures than polyurethane, usually up to about 155\u00b0C. If your project is in an environment where the wire might come into contact with chemicals or needs to withstand more mechanical stress, polyester enamel wire might be the way to go.<\/p>\n<p><strong>Polyimide Enamel<\/strong>: For high &#8211; temperature and high &#8211; performance applications, polyimide enamel wires are the best. They can handle temperatures up to 220\u00b0C or even higher in some cases. These wires are often used in aerospace, military, and other high &#8211; tech industries where reliability under extreme conditions is crucial. But they can be a bit more expensive, so you&#8217;ll need to weigh the cost against the benefits for your project.<\/p>\n<h3>Look at the Wire Size and Gauge<\/h3>\n<p>The size and gauge of the enamel wire are key factors. As I mentioned earlier, the gauge determines how much current the wire can carry. The American Wire Gauge (AWG) system is commonly used to measure wire thickness. A lower AWG number means a thicker wire.<\/p>\n<p>For example, if you&#8217;re working on a project with a high &#8211; power requirement, you&#8217;ll probably need a thicker wire with a lower AWG number. But remember, thicker wires also take up more space. If you&#8217;re working in a confined area, you might have to compromise and choose a slightly thinner wire that can still handle the required current.<\/p>\n<p>You also need to consider the length of the wire. Longer wires have more electrical resistance, which can lead to power losses. So, if you&#8217;re using a long wire in your project, you might need to go for a thicker gauge to minimize these losses.<\/p>\n<h3>Check the Quality and Certification<\/h3>\n<p>When you&#8217;re choosing an enamel wire, quality is non &#8211; negotiable. You want a wire that&#8217;s going to perform well and last a long time. Look for wires that are made from high &#8211; quality copper or aluminum. Copper is a better conductor than aluminum, but aluminum is lighter and cheaper.<\/p>\n<p>Certification is also important. Reputable enamel wire suppliers will have their products certified to meet certain standards, such as ISO or UL standards. These certifications ensure that the wire has been tested and meets the required safety and performance criteria.
